在当今互联网时代,GitHub Pages(即github.io)已成为开发者和内容创作者广泛使用的平台之一。然而,有些用户在使用此平台时会遇到“关机无法访问”的问题,导致他们的网站无法正常运行。本文将详细分析这一问题的成因,提供相应的解决方案,并解答用户在使用GitHub Pages时常见的疑问。
目录
- 什么是GitHub Pages
- GitHub.io关机无法访问的原因
- 如何解决GitHub.io关机无法访问的问题
- 3.1 检查网络连接
- 3.2 检查GitHub服务状态
- 3.3 查看代码是否存在问题
- 3.4 清理浏览器缓存
- 如何预防GitHub.io关机无法访问
- FAQ
- 5.1 GitHub.io关机无法访问会影响我的项目吗?
- 5.2 我该如何联系GitHub支持?
- 5.3 有哪些替代的GitHub Pages服务?
- 5.4 GitHub Pages是否需要付费?
什么是GitHub Pages
GitHub Pages是一项由GitHub提供的服务,允许用户直接从其GitHub仓库托管静态网站。用户只需创建一个特定格式的仓库并上传其网站内容,GitHub将自动为其生成一个可访问的URL,通常为username.github.io
。
GitHub Pages的优点
- 免费托管:用户可以享受免费的网站托管服务。
- 易于使用:无论是新手还是有经验的开发者,都可以轻松上手。
- 版本控制:通过GitHub的版本控制系统,用户可以随时恢复到之前的版本。
GitHub.io关机无法访问的原因
出现“关机无法访问”的问题,可能有多种原因,包括但不限于:
- 网络问题:本地网络不稳定或断开。
- GitHub服务宕机:GitHub服务器出现故障,导致无法访问。
- 代码问题:项目代码存在错误或不兼容。
- 浏览器缓存:缓存问题可能导致页面加载错误。
如何解决GitHub.io关机无法访问的问题
3.1 检查网络连接
首先,确认你的网络连接是否正常。可以通过尝试访问其他网站或使用ping命令来测试网络连接。
3.2 检查GitHub服务状态
访问 GitHub状态页面 检查GitHub的服务状态。如果GitHub的服务出现问题,那么你只能耐心等待他们修复。
3.3 查看代码是否存在问题
在代码方面,你需要检查是否有任何明显的错误,比如:
- 文件路径是否正确
- 使用的主题是否被支持
- 必要的文件(如
index.html
)是否存在
3.4 清理浏览器缓存
如果确认以上问题都不是原因,可以尝试清理浏览器缓存。
- 在浏览器设置中找到“清理缓存”选项,并清除浏览器的缓存。
- 尝试使用隐身模式访问网站,看是否能够正常加载。
如何预防GitHub.io关机无法访问
- 定期备份:定期备份你的项目代码,确保数据安全。
- 监控服务状态:使用第三方服务监控GitHub的运行状态。
- 使用版本控制:在代码发生变更时,确保使用版本控制,能够方便地回滚到以前的版本。
FAQ
5.1 GitHub.io关机无法访问会影响我的项目吗?
如果你的项目依赖于GitHub Pages,关机无法访问确实会对项目的可用性产生影响,用户可能无法访问你的网站。
5.2 我该如何联系GitHub支持?
你可以通过 GitHub支持页面 提交问题,或者在他们的社区论坛中寻求帮助。
5.3 有哪些替代的GitHub Pages服务?
如果你想要尝试其他的静态网站托管服务,可以考虑以下选项:
- Netlify
- Vercel
- Firebase Hosting
5.4 GitHub Pages是否需要付费?
GitHub Pages是免费的,适用于公开仓库。但是,若你使用私人仓库,可能会涉及到GitHub的收费套餐。
通过以上的解析和建议,希望能够帮助你解决“GitHub.io关机无法访问”的问题,让你的网站始终保持可用。如果你有更多问题,欢迎在下方留言讨论!
正文完